Lodging Managers Salary
Lodging Managers in Colorado Springs, CO make a median of $80,060 a year, or about $38.49 an hour. The range runs from $57K at the entry level to $175K for experienced workers.

Compensation breakdown
Annual earnings by percentile, Colorado Springs, CO
Entry-level lodging managers (10th percentile) start around $57K. Mid-career wages sit at $80K. Top earners bring in $175K or more, a $118K spread from bottom to top.

How much do lodging managers make in Colorado Springs, CO?
The median is $80,060 a year, that works out to about $38 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$56,900, and experienced lodging managers can clear $174,840.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
